Animal Foods Only

The carnivore approach, strictly defined, includes only animal-derived products with no plant matter. This means:

Permitted Foods:

  • Meat (beef, pork, lamb, etc.)

  • Fish and seafood

  • Eggs

  • Dairy products

The approach eliminates all plant-based foods, including vegetables, fruits, grains, legumes, nuts, and seeds. This stands in contrast to many conventional dietary recommendations that emphasize grain products and plant foods.

Some ongoing debates exist around borderline items such as:

  • Coffee

  • Honey

  • Certain fruits

These discussions highlight the evolving nature of the carnivore approach as practitioners and researchers continue to refine its parameters. Despite its seemingly straightforward definition, implementation varies among individuals, with some following stricter interpretations than others.

The key distinction between this approach and other low-carbohydrate diets is the complete elimination of plant foods rather than just the reduction of carbohydrates. This makes it perhaps the most restrictive of the low-carbohydrate eating patterns currently practiced.

Medical Assessment and Evidence Review

Recent meta-analyses provide more nuanced perspectives than conventional wisdom suggests:

  1. Cardiovascular health: Recent meta-analyses don't conclusively show saturated fat increasing LDL cholesterol. Some research indicates low saturated fat intake may increase lipoprotein(a), a genetic LDL variant linked to heart disease.

  2. Kidney stones: Evidence suggests processed red meat might increase kidney stone risk, but not consumption of dairy, fish, or poultry. Many studies show methodological limitations.

  3. Gout associations: A 2024 meta-analysis indicated red meat might increase gout risk by 27%, but this is lower than other factors like fructose (29%), seafood (40%), and alcohol (41%).

  4. Bone density: Contrary to concerns, research published in June 2024 with 17,000 participants demonstrated protein-rich diets increased bone density and reduced hip fracture risk.

  5. Kidney function: While animal protein can increase serum creatinine, recent evidence published in JAMA shows high animal protein consumption associated with 20% decreased risk of death from kidney disease.

  6. Cancer connections: A 2024 meta-analysis of 95 studies found increased gastrointestinal cancer risk with processed meat consumption. However, fish intake appeared to decrease colorectal cancer risk. Researchers noted insufficient evidence to establish causation between red meat and cancer.

Many studies examining meat consumption suffer from methodological limitations and fail to separate the effects of meat from other dietary and lifestyle factors.

Analyzing Health Evidence

Animal Fat and Blood Cholesterol

Recent comprehensive research challenges long-held beliefs about animal fat consumption. The latest meta-analysis doesn't confirm that saturated fats from animal sources directly increase LDL cholesterol levels. Interestingly, another meta-analysis published in September suggests that consuming low amounts of saturated fats might actually increase lipoprotein(a), a genetic variation of LDL known to be a risk factor for heart disease.

Saturated fat appears less dangerous than traditionally portrayed in medical literature. The main concern seems not to be animal fat itself, but rather consuming it alongside ultra-processed carbohydrates. When combined with ultra-processed carbs, the body's insulin response can impair fat metabolism.

Risk of Kidney Stones

The relationship between meat consumption and kidney stones remains complex. Recent meta-analyses indicate a potential increased risk associated specifically with processed red meat consumption, but not with dairy, fish, poultry, or milk products.

Many studies in this area suffer from low quality and significant bias risk. The theoretical mechanism involves increased uric acid levels from red meat consumption, but evidence remains inconclusive despite public perception of strong causation.

Red Meat and Gout

A September meta-analysis suggests red meat could increase gout risk by approximately 27%. However, this risk pales in comparison to other factors:

Risk Factor Increased Risk Red Meat 27% Fructose 29% Seafood 40% Alcohol 41%

These studies are primarily observational, limiting their strength as evidence. Few studies isolate red meat consumption from other influential factors like alcohol and fructose consumption, which appear to present significantly greater risks for gout development.

Bone Health and Protein Consumption

Research published in June involving 17,000 participants demonstrated that protein-rich diets actually increase bone density and reduce hip fracture risk. This finding directly contradicts previous assumptions about animal protein and bone health.

The data suggests protein-rich diets may be protective rather than harmful for bone health, challenging long-established nutritional paradigms.

Kidney Function and Animal Protein

While animal protein consumption can increase serum creatinine levels (used to calculate kidney function), this doesn't necessarily translate to kidney disease or failure risk. Recent evidence published in August in the Journal of the American Medical Association revealed that higher animal protein intake is actually associated with a 20% decreased risk of death from kidney disease.

This represents another case where the evidence contradicts common concerns. For most individuals, animal proteins appear less dangerous for kidney function than conditions like pre-diabetes and diabetes, which are primarily driven by excessive carbohydrate consumption.

Processed Meat and Cancer Risk

A comprehensive meta-analysis published in June 2024 examined 95 studies involving over 5 million participants. The findings showed increased gastrointestinal cancer risk—particularly colorectal cancer—in individuals consuming significant quantities of processed meat products.

Conversely, high fish intake appeared to decrease colorectal and other gastrointestinal cancer risks. However, most research in this area relies on observational studies, which provide lower-quality evidence. The authors themselves acknowledged insufficient evidence to establish that unprocessed red meat causes cancer.
